A “Mediterranean” approach to eating with an emphasis on paying attention to your portion sizes. A Mediterranean style diet is a plant based diet that includes low to moderate amounts of fish and poultry and includes olive oil as the main source of fat. Dairy products like cheese and yogurt are allowable, but red meat is limited. Wine is consumed in low to moderate amounts. And you can enjoy a Mediterranean diet delivered to your door with ediets meal delivery! The author of this popular diet is a registered dietitian (like me!) and professor of nutrition. Her approach is simple: Eat small portions of good quality foods. No weighing, measuring, or calorie counting is required. As with many other weight loss diets, you’ll advance through 3 phases (called “waves”) while following this diet. The first “wave,” which lasts 10 days, is the most restrictive. It is the linear descendant of the Mediterranean diet; a subset, if you will. It takes the standard Mediterranean diet and extracts those key features that make it unique and effective, then distills the whole thing down to a less-complicated action plan for healthy eating. You can see the Sonoma diet as a simplified Mediterranean diet, only re-purposed to promote weight loss and general healthy eating.
